2019 Yamaha DRIVE2 (DR2E) recalls

1 safety recall campaign has been filed for the 2019 Yamaha DRIVE2 (DR2E) with Transport Canada and the U.S. NHTSA. Here is what both agencies say.

  • Electrical#2019349

    778 units affected

    Issue: On certain golf cars, an incorrect fuse for the USB accessory ports may have been installed. As a result, the USB voltage-reducer module could overheat and possibly cause a fire. Safety Risk: A fire could create the risk of injury. Corrective Actions: Yamaha will notify owners by mail and instruct them to take their vehicle to a dealer to inspect the fuse for the USB accessory ports. If incorrect, it will be replaced with the proper 1-A fuse. Note: Owners are advised to not use either USB accessory port until the recall repairs are completed.
